"Weak schedule" is a weak argument.

 

First of all, SOS is a composite that glosses over the individual match-ups. (Face four 1-loss teams and six 1-win teams and the SOS is .42 ...or just slightly higher than the .39 those 'phins faced... but that doesn't make those 1-loss teams "weak" by any stretch of the imagination)

 

Second, is an SOS of, say, .600 really that different from an SOS of .400? (see point one and point three) I'd be curious to see how many teams have had an SOS within even 5% deviation from the '72 'phins....probably like, what, 5-6 dozen? And how'd they do...??

 

Finally, the "weak sked" argument ignores the ever-important "Any Given Sunday" maxim. 'Nuff said.

 

 

 

Oh and by the way, if you buy that argument....the Pats sked so far? 17-28, or a win % of .3777, "weaker" than the '72 Dolphins.

 

 

That said, I *DO* think that teams today have it "tougher" than the '72 'phins in terms of acheiving that Holy Grail of professional football, as there are more teams (talent is thinner) and they play more games (obvious disadvantage), not to mention that the quality of NFL players has increased starkly in the decades since their record-setting season....
